Anuja Jhingran, M.D.

Present Title & Affiliation

Primary Appointment

Professor, Department of Radiation Oncology, Division of Radiation Oncology, The University of Texas M. D. Anderson Cancer Center, Houston, TX

Education & Training

Degree-Granting Education

1988 Texas Tech University, Health Science Center, Lubbock, TX, MD, Medicine
1984 Smith College, North Hampton, MA, BA, Biochemistry

Postgraduate Training

7/1992-6/1993 Chief Resident Department of Radiation Oncology, Radiation Oncology, Baylor College of Medicine, Houston, TX, Shiao Woo, M.D.
7/1989-6/1993 Residency Department of Radiation Oncology, Radiation Oncology, Baylor College of Medicine, Houston, TX, Shiao Woo, M.D.
7/1988-6/1989 Internal Medicine, Baylor College of Medicine, Houston, TX, Edward Lynch, M.D.

Board Certifications

1993 American Board of Radiology-Radiation Oncology

Experience/Service

Academic Appointments

Associate Professor, Department of Radiation Oncology, Division of Radiation Oncology, The University of Texas M. D. Anderson Cancer Center, Houston, TX, 9/2002-8/2009
